By default, text is _____ in a cell

A.) left-aligned
b.) centered
C.) justified
D.) right-aligned

To answer this question, I am assuming you are talking about a table in a word document or a spreadsheet. The answer is A - left-aligned.

For text to be centred, justified or right-aligned, the user needs to highlight the cell and set one of these options manually. You cannot set the text in a single cell to be left-aligned, centered and right-aligned at the same time. All three are mutually exclusive which means text can only be set to any one of the three justifications.
